Roof racks are an incredible addition that augments your Fusion's storage capability, making it a breeze to carry sports equipment, luggage, and other outdoor essentials.
They come in a range of styles tailored to specific needs and tastes:
Crossbar Roof Racks are the go-to for many. These are comprised of horizontal bars that span the width of the Fusion's roof, acting as a foundation for various attachments - think cargo carriers, bike or ski racks, and kayak mounts.

You can mount crossbar roof racks on a Ford Fusion model with either raised factory-installed side rails or a bare roof using specific mounting systems.
Raised Side Rail Roof Racks. These roof racks feature rails that stretch from the front to the rear of your Fusion's roof.
These are perfect if you're looking for a combo of style and utility for your Fusion.
Flush-Mount Side Rail Roof Racks are also fitted with factory-installed rails, but these sit flush against the Fusion's roof for a sleek aerodynamic design.
Roof Baskets and Cargo Trays. These roof racks come in handy when you've got bulky items to transport.
Cargo Boxes are your best bet if you're after weather-proof storage on your Fusion's roof. Check out these cargo boxes which offer ample space for gear, ensuring they remain dry and safe.

Bike Racks. Whether it's a trail or a city ride, transporting your bike is a breeze with these racks. Look into roof-mounted options for your Fusion.

Kayak and Canoe Carriers. If water adventures are your thing, you'll love these carriers specifically designed to secure your kayak or canoe in place during transit.
Ski and Snowboard Racks. For those snowy adventures, you need a reliable rack to transport your skis and snowboards. These racks are tailor-made for the job, ensuring your gear remains secure.

First things first: always check the roof rack manual. Different Ford Fusion models might have different quirks, and you want to get it right.
Find a level spot to park your Fusion. Ensure the doors and windows are sealed up tight. And if you've got any pre-existing rails, see if they need any adjustments.
Break out that measuring tape and mark the proper distance for your crossbars, as per the instructions. Lay those crossbars across the roof just like the manual tells you.
If your kit came with mounting feet, attach them to those crossbars as instructed. Make sure they're snug but not too tight.
Once the feet are on, position the crossbars evenly across the Fusion's roof.
Ensure your crossbars are spaced out just right and in line, just as the manual says. If you got a kit with adjustable feet, make sure they're nice and aligned with your Fusion's roof contour.

Get those bolts or screws holding the crossbars down nice and snug. But don't go full throttle on them, you don't want to damage anything.
Make sure there's enough clearance between the bars and your Fusion's roof. And double-check your doors swing open without any hassle.
Gently test out the stability of your setup. If something feels a bit off, tighten it up.
Now's the fun part! Throw on some cargo boxes or maybe even a surfboard. Just make sure to consult the manual if you're unsure about something.
Run a final look over everything. Make sure it's all snug and properly tightened down.
Place a towel or cloth under the roof rack mounting points to avoid any scratches down the road. If you're not feeling too confident, maybe get a pro or a buddy to give you a hand.
